What data analyst postings actually require

We split every skill by whether a posting called it required or preferred. Two skills gate the role, SQL and data analysis, while the visualization tools job seekers focus on sit a level below as preferences. Lead your resume in this order.

Required first, preferred second

  1. SQL: 71% of postings, required in 61%. The clearest gate to the job.
  2. Data analysis: 62% of postings, almost always required.
  3. Python: 46%, split about evenly between required and preferred.
  4. Data visualization: 42% of postings.
  5. Tableau: About a third, but preferred nearly twice as often as required.
  6. Power BI: 27%, and it leans preferred rather than required.
  7. Communication: About a third, and required roughly nine times out of ten.
  8. Excel: 24%, and usually required.
  9. Analytical skills: 24% of postings.
  10. Problem-solving: 22% of postings.
  11. R: 20%, and it leans preferred, a bonus rather than a gate.
  12. Attention to detail: 14% of postings.

The pay backs up the demand. Across 12,330 data analyst postings that listed a salary range, the average ran about $83,000 to $111,000, so the required skills above are worth the effort to prove.

Top data analyst skills for your resume

These are the skills that show up most across data analyst postings, grouped so you can scan them. Copy any that fit your experience, then prove them in your bullet points.

Languages and querying

SQL

A query language for retrieving, joining, and transforming data held in relational databases.

What data analysts who got interviews listed

We also read the resumes of data analysts whose tracked applications reached an interview. The skills they listed most matched the demand at the top, then went a layer deeper into the Python stack that job posts rarely name. Most-listed skills on resumes that reached interviews

  1. Python: 26 people
  2. SQL: 25 people
  3. Tableau: 22 people
  4. Excel: 13 people
  5. Power BI: 12 people
  6. pandas and NumPy: 11 and 10 people, though postings rarely name them

How to showcase data analyst skills on your resume

Listing a skill is not enough; show how you used it and what changed. For the wider tools-and-software family these belong to, see technical skills.

Use strong action verbs

  1. Analyzed: Analyzed 18 months of funnel data and cut acquisition cost 22%.
  2. Built: Built a Tableau dashboard used weekly by a 30-person sales team.
  3. Automated: Automated a monthly report in Python, replacing a two-day manual pull.
  4. Queried: Wrote SQL across four databases to cut a weekly report from six hours to 20 minutes.

Quantify your impact

  1. Add a number: A recruiter believes a result they can measure, so attach a figure to each skill.
  2. Name the audience: Say who used your analysis: a team, a client, the leadership group.
  3. Show the change: Lead with what improved, in percent, dollars, or time saved.

Answers for analysts building a resume

What are the top skills for a data analyst resume?

SQL and data analysis first, since employers required them in 61% and 62% of postings. Add Python, a visualization tool such as Tableau or Power BI, and clear communication, and lead with the required ones.

Is SQL or Python more important for a data analyst?

SQL. It appeared in 71% of postings and was required in 61%, while Python appeared in 46% and split evenly between required and preferred. Build SQL to a strong level first, then add Python.

How many skills should a data analyst resume list?

Usually 10 to 15, enough to cover the required ones and the tools the job names. Group them by languages, tools, and methods, and prove your top few inside your bullets.

What keywords do data analyst resumes need?

SQL, data analysis, Python, and data visualization, then the exact BI tool a posting names. Applicant tracking systems scan for the specific terms, so mirror the description's wording.

Our sample and method

For this guide we read 65,263 job posts with the base title data analyst, then recorded whether each listed skill was tagged required or preferred. Every percentage is out of those 65,263 posts. Close variants such as power bi and powerbi were merged, and the interview counts come from data analysts whose tracked applications reached an interview, counted per person.
